Output 85fecc9a5d3598854ec2fb36623a5168d21962e04eba8b2b2d4b4a11e8fc534b:0

value
303963600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d9b4a56185d8183cf48a14532c0a61f217210b7 OP_EQUAL
address
3G4N3Re4P2LPKV1YGSuCECeDTqiEVQpzZA
transaction
85fecc9a5d3598854ec2fb36623a5168d21962e04eba8b2b2d4b4a11e8fc534b
spent
true